- -
UPV
 

Projecte DECODER

La UPV participa en la creació d'una innovadora metodologia i eines que simplifiquen el desenvolupament de nous programes informàtics

[ 20/12/2021 ]

El programari és un dels pilars de tot el sector productiu i de la nostra societat en general. Està present a tot arreu i d'ell depèn des del correcte funcionament d'infraestructures crítiques com el subministrament d'energia i el transport, fins als dispositius intel·ligents que ens connecten a Internet, entre altres moltíssims exemples. Ara bé, el desenvolupament d'aquests programes continua sent avui dia molt costós, degut fonamentalment a la complexitat cada vegada major dels sistemes informàtics.

Ara, personal investigador de la Universitat Politècnica de València (UPV), pertanyent a l'Institut Valencià d'Intel·ligència Artificial (VRAIN), ha participat en el desenvolupament d'una innovadora metodologia i eines que faciliten al màxim la creació de nous programes informàtics, augmentant notablement la productivitat dels desenvolupadors. Aquest és el principal resultat de DECODER, un projecte europeu coordinat per la companyia austríaca Technikon, en el qual han participat a més altres cinc empreses de França, Espanya i Alemanya.

“Un procés de desenvolupament típic d'un programa informàtic requereix interaccions de moltes parts interessades, en nivells d'abstracció molt diferents. Això fa que el desenvolupament, i també el manteniment dels sistemes de programari, siga extremadament complicat i ineficient: es malgasta molt temps i es prenen decisions equivocades perquè molta informació sobre un projecte no es recopila i documenta adequadament. Els enginyers de programari necessiten ajuda per al desenvolupament dels programes i aquesta és la que li aporta DECODER”, destaca Tanja Vos, investigadora del centre PROS en l'Institut VRAIN de la Politècnica de València.

Així, DECODER ofereix als programadors un sistema intel·ligent integrat per eines de programari lliure i una innovadora metodologia que els facilita el seu treball diari. “Avui dia hi ha moltes eines que permeten extraure informació sobre un programari, ja siga del seu codi, requisits, etc. El que hem fet ha sigut ajuntar totes elles en un repositori central, el Persistance Knowledge Monitor-PKM. Fent ús d'ell, el desenvolupador del programari podrà prendre decisions molt més encertades, ràpides i intel·ligents per al correcte funcionament del programa en el qual està treballant”, afig Tanja VOS.

Redueix la corba d'aprenentatge

Al mateix temps, les eines i metodologia desenvolupades en el marc d'aquest projecte redueixen també la corba d'aprenentatge i augmenten la productivitat tant dels programadors com dels encarregats del manteniment d'aquest.

“Imaginem que una empresa requereix d'un programari amb uns requisits determinats i compta amb un nou equip de desenvolupadors: la corba d'aprenentatge per a qui entra en l'empresa i ha de desenvolupar el programa és avui dia molt complexa. Aquest PKM facilita el seu treball, augmenta la seua productivitat, els dóna més informació, els permet aportar solucions intel·ligents, per a garantir aqueixes qualitat, seguretat i funcionalitat del programari, en un temps molt de menor del qual es requereix actualment”, explica Tanja Vós.

En el cas dels enginyers encarregats del seu manteniment, el PKM els facilitarà conèixer a l'instant tots els “secrets” del programari en qüestió. “Permet saber què, com i amb quines eines es va desenvolupar i, d'aquesta manera, extraure un coneixement del projecte que difícilment s'obtindria actualment en els repositoris programari existent”, afig Vos.

Notícies destacades


Acabar amb la pobresa infantil a Espanya augmentaria el PIB un 5'7% Acabar amb la pobresa infantil a Espanya augmentaria el PIB un 5'7%
La pobresa infantil a Espanya, a debat en unes jornades organitzades per la Càtedra d'Infància i Adolescència de la UPV, a Torrevella
QS rànquings per matèries QS rànquings per matèries
La UPV, reconeguda com a millor universitat d'Espanya per a estudiar tant Enginyeria Agroalimentària i Forestal com Art i Disseny
L''Escola de Disseny' canvia de nom L''Escola de Disseny' canvia de nom
L'ETSEADI (Escola Tècnica Superior d'Enginyeria Aeroespacial i Disseny Industrial) substitueix la denominació d'ETSED
La UPV, en la semifinal de Solo de Ciencia La UPV, en la semifinal de Solo de Ciencia
Entre els deu semifinalistes, es troben Miguel López, investigador del CVBLab-Human Tech i Carolina Rober, doctoranda en la UPV
Primers passos del museu Ciéncia fallera de la UPV Primers passos del museu Ciéncia fallera de la UPV
La UPV celebra l'acte de lliurament de premis del I concurs "La Ciència a les Falles". Els ninots guanyadors, els primers d'aquest nou museu de la universitat
UPV-CLÍNIC UPV-CLÍNIC
La UPV i INCLIVA signen un conveni per a impulsar conjuntament la innovació en l'àmbit de la salut



EMAS upv